Bennett Close is a residential street with 7 addresses.
It ranks as the 117th largest and 488th most expensive of the 614 streets in the PE36 area. The dominant property type is a modern house built after 1980.
The street contains a total of 7 properties: 7 houses.
Sale prices range from £267,527 for 2 bedroom freehold houses with a garden (635 ft2) to £469,773 for 4 bedroom freehold houses with a garden (1,698 ft2) .
Monthly rental prices range from £1,178 pcm for 2 bed houses to £1,831 pcm for 4 bed houses.
The gross rental yield is between 4.7% and 5.3%.
The average value per square foot is £382.
The last sale on Bennett Close sold for £230,000 on 12th December 2016. Since then prices are up an average of 29.2%.
The current average value in the street is £326,029.
The Bennett Close Sales Market has increased by 38.9% over the last 10 years.

The last sale was on 12th December 2016 for £230,000 and since then the market in the area has increased by 29.2%. The street has had a total of 11 sales since 1995.
Bennett Close, Hunstanton, PE36 has seen no sales in the last three years and no sales in the last twelve months.
Bennett Close, Hunstanton, PE36 is the 117th largest and the 488th most expensive street in the PE36 area.
There is 1 postcode on Bennett Close, Hunstanton, PE36.
The closest station to Bennett Close, Hunstanton, PE36 is Kings Lynn station which is 20.4 kilometres away.
